DEF: Western Asset Diversified Income Fund Announces Annual Meeting of Shareholders
Proxy Statement
Western Asset Diversified Income Fund will hold its Annual Meeting of Shareholders on April 14, 2025, to vote on the election of trustees and the ratification of independent public accountants.
Summary
- Western Asset Diversified Income Fund (WDI) will hold its Annual Meeting of Shareholders on April 14, 2025, in New York.
- Shareholders will vote on the election of three Class I Trustees and the ratification of PricewaterhouseCoopers LLP (PwC) as the independent registered public accountants for the fiscal year ending December 31, 2025.
- The record date for determining shareholders eligible to vote is February 7, 2025.
- The Board of Trustees recommends voting FOR the election of the trustee nominees and FOR the ratification of PwC.
- At the Record Date, the Fund had outstanding 51,788,210 Common Shares.
- The Fund expects to bear approximately $39,132 in expenses related to the proxy solicitation.

Risks
- The Fund is subject to the Maryland Control Share Acquisition Act (MCSAA), which could restrict the voting rights of shareholders who acquire control shares.
- If shareholders do not provide specific voting instructions, their shares may not be voted at all or may be voted in a manner they may not intend.
- The Board's risk management oversight is subject to substantial limitations.

Management Changes
| Role | Previous Person | New Person | Effective Date | Reason |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Trustee | Daniel P. Cronin | NA | December 31, 2024 | Resigned from the Board |
| Trustee | Paolo M. Cucchi | NA | December 31, 2024 | Resigned from the Board |
| Trustee | NA | Anthony Grillo | November 15, 2024 | New Trustee |
| Trustee | NA | Hillary Sale | November 15, 2024 | New Trustee |
| Trustee | NA | Peter Mason | November 15, 2024 | New Trustee |

Key Dates
| Date | Description |
|---|---|
| February 7, 2025 | Record date for determining shareholders entitled to notice of and to vote at the Annual Meeting. |
| February 20, 2025 | Date of the Audit Committee meeting. |
| March 7, 2025 | Date of the Notice of Annual Meeting of Shareholders and Proxy Statement. |
| April 14, 2025 | Date of the Annual Meeting of Shareholders. |
| October 8, 2025 | Earliest date for shareholders to submit proposals for the 2026 Annual Meeting without including the proposal in the Funds proxy statement. |
| November 7, 2025 | Deadline for shareholders to submit proposals for inclusion in the Funds proxy statement for the 2026 Annual Meeting of Shareholders. |
| December 31, 2025 | Fiscal year end for which PwC is selected as independent registered public accountants. |
